> So, this single-file HTML builder should be a good starting point for rst2pdf 
> integration (perhaps just changing calls to the HTML writer to the rst2pdf-
> provided writer). I would appreciate any pointers in that direction, too.

Actually the latex builder should be a pretty good starting point, since it
also mashes together all doctrees to form a single large one, which is then
translated by the writer.
